Line and continuum observations carried out by the EVN at 1.6 GHz show an emission structure in the central region of 1 square arcsec in the Megamaser galaxy Mrk 273. The detected hydroxyl emission reveals an unexpected view on the molecular environment, with emission up to a spatial extend of 240 mas towards only one nuclear source. The hydroxyl emission itself is partially superposed on the continuum emission and shows a moderately high main--line ratio, which suggests optically thin maser emission with a more complex pumping scheme. The line--of--sight velocities indicate the organized structure of an edge--on disk/TORUS with Keplerian rotation around a central object with a mass of 3.5 times 108Msun. The observed continuum emission displays three individual regions with self--absorbed synchrotron radio spectra. Combined with existing HI observations they may reveal a third nucleus toward the southeast taking part in a merging scenario.
